Output 76010ebafe7572638c9188041bad51c5ed80b7ad19d92150b873066a8f795cbe:1

value
73608579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ebe6c65ae3eceaa5aba85f36e6a3e533b977d4f OP_EQUAL
address
MRHijjGcQ67tiGn4ei7aHBJb44TK4btmeQ
transaction
76010ebafe7572638c9188041bad51c5ed80b7ad19d92150b873066a8f795cbe
spent
true